Ingredients
- Rye Whiskey60 ml / 2 ozA Pennsylvania-style rye is recommended for authenticity, but any good quality rye whiskey will work well.
- Fresh Lime Juice15 ml / 0.5 ozFreshly squeezed juice is essential for the best flavor.
- Ginger Beer120 ml / 4 ozChoose a high-quality, spicy ginger beer rather than a milder ginger ale. Top up to taste.
- Angostura Bitters2 dashes(optional)Adds aromatic complexity and depth to the drink.

Garnishing
- Lime Wheel: A fresh wheel or wedge of lime placed on the rim or in the drink.
- Mint Sprig: A fresh sprig of mint, gently clapped between the hands to release its aroma before placing in the drink.

Similar Cocktails
Moscow Mule
The original, which uses vodka as the base spirit instead of rye whiskey.
Kentucky Mule
Uses bourbon instead of rye, resulting in a slightly sweeter, less spicy profile.
London Mule
Uses gin, which adds a botanical, juniper-forward character to the drink.
Mexican Mule
Features tequila as the base, lending an earthy, agave note.
Dark 'n' Stormy
A similar profile using dark rum, though traditionally served without stirring to create a layered effect.
